Visual field testing on the Envision head-mounted perimeter with and without gaming elements.

Emmanouil Tsamis, Iván Marín-Franch, William H Swanson

    Ophthalmology. Glaucoma
    |April 17, 2026
    PubMed
    Summary
    This summary is machine-generated.

    The new Envision virtual reality (VR) perimeter, including its gaming-based test (ENVg), shows high repeatability and accuracy comparable to the Humphrey Field Analyzer (HFA) for visual field testing.

    Area of Science:

    • Ophthalmology
    • Medical Technology
    • Visual Science

    Background:

    • Visual field testing is crucial for diagnosing and monitoring glaucoma.
    • Traditional perimetry devices like the Humphrey Field Analyzer (HFA) can be time-consuming and may lead to patient fatigue.
    • Novel approaches using virtual reality (VR) offer potential improvements in patient experience and efficiency.

    Purpose of the Study:

    • To evaluate the Envision VR perimeter's test-retest variability and compare its performance against the HFA.
    • To assess the duration and patient preferences for two Envision test modes: standard (ENV) and gaming-based (ENVg).

    Main Methods:

    • A two-part clinical trial involving 30 healthy controls and 30 glaucoma patients.
    • Participants underwent testing with Envision (ENV and ENVg) and HFA.
    • Test-retest variability, concordance, test duration, and patient preferences were analyzed.

    Main Results:

    • Envision (ENV and ENVg) demonstrated low test-retest variability, comparable to the HFA.
    • Visual field results (TD/MD values) were similar across Envision and HFA.
    • The ENVg mode was strongly preferred by patients for its engagement and shorter duration.

    Conclusions:

    • The Envision VR perimeter is a repeatable and accurate alternative to the HFA for visual field testing.
    • The ENVg mode shows potential for enhancing patient compliance and engagement.
    • Envision's portability and consistent test duration make it suitable for diverse clinical settings.
